有效软件测试的50条建议(effectivesoftwaretesting50specificwaystoimproveyourtesting)..doc

有效软件测试的50条建议(effectivesoftwaretesting50specificwaystoimproveyourtesting)..doc

  1. 1、本文档共35页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
有效软件测试的50条建议(effectivesoftwaretesting50specificwaystoimproveyourtesting).

Chapter 1. Requirements Phase 第一章 需求阶段 The most effective testing programs start at the beginning of a project, long before any program code has been written. The requirements documentation is verified first; then, in the later stages of the project, testing can concentrate on ensuring the quality of the application code. Expensive reworking is minimized by eliminating requirements-related defects early in the projects life, prior to detailed design or coding work. 最有效的测试工作开始于项目的开始阶段,远远早于程序的编码阶段。首先需要检查需求文档;然后,在项目的后期阶段,测试就可以专注于保证程序代码的质量。在项目生命周期中,也就是详细设计和编码之前,消除需求相关的缺陷能够将昂贵的返工工作降低最低。 The requirements specifications for a software application or system must ultimately describe its functionality in great detail. One of the most challenging aspects of requirements development is communicating with the people who are supplying the requirements. Each requirement should be stated precisely and clearly, so it can be understood in the same way by everyone who reads it. 软件应用程序或者系统的需求规格说明必须非常详细的描述它的功能。确定需求最具挑战之一的工作是和提供需求的人员交流。每一条需求都应该被准确和清晰的阐述,以便阅读需求的每个人都可以以同样的方式理解需求。 If there is a consistent way of documenting requirements, it is possible for the stakeholders responsible for requirements gathering to effectively participate in the requirements process. As soon as a requirement is made visible, it can be tested and clarified by asking the stakeholders detailed questions. A variety of requirement tests can be applied to ensure that each requirement is relevant, and that everyone has the same understanding of its meaning. 如果使用了一致的方法来撰写需求,那么需求收集人员就有可能有效的 参与需求过程。一旦某条需求有了可见性,那么通过详细咨询相关人员这条需求就可以被测试和澄清了。各种各样的需求测试可以用来确保每条需求是恰当的,并且大家对它的含义也有相同的理解。 Item 1: Involve Testers from the Beginning 第1条:测试人员及早介入 Testers need to be involved from the beginning of a projects life cycle so they can understand exactly what they are testing and can work with other stakeholders to create testable requirements. 测试人员需要项目从项目生命周期之初就要介入,以便他们能准确的理解他们正在做的测试和其他参与人员一起生成可测试的需求。 Defect prevention is the

文档评论(0)

fglgf11gf21gI +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档